Real-World Testing: Putting Hawke Sport Optics 2pc 1in Weaver High 1in Extension Rings to the Test

First Use Experience

My first test of the Hawke Sport Optics rings was at my local shooting range, mounting a Vortex Viper PST 1-4×24 on a Mauser 98 action chambered in .30-06. The range offered a variety of distances, from 25 to 200 yards, allowing me to assess the scope’s performance and the rings’ ability to maintain zero. The weather was dry and mild, providing ideal conditions for testing.

The rings were straightforward to install on the Weaver rail. I appreciated the double hex screws. They allowed for even torque distribution, minimizing the risk of crushing the scope tube. Achieving proper eye relief was immediately improved because of the 1-inch extension.

After the first 20 rounds, I carefully checked the rings and scope for any signs of slippage or movement. Everything remained secure. I was pleased to see no visible marks on the scope tube, thanks to the internal cushion tape. Initial zeroing was easy, and the rifle held zero consistently throughout the initial testing.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of use and approximately 300 rounds fired, the Hawke Sport Optics rings have held up reasonably well. There are some minor cosmetic scratches on the anodized finish from handling and transport, but this is to be expected.

The rings have remained securely mounted. The scope hasn’t shifted, even after a few rough handling incidents during transport. Cleaning is simple. A quick wipe down with a lightly oiled cloth keeps them looking good and prevents corrosion.

Compared to some higher-end rings I’ve used, such as those from Seekins Precision, the Hawke Sport Optics rings don’t offer the same level of precision or rock-solid feel. However, given the significant price difference, they offer a very acceptable level of performance. They haven’t disappointed me, and they’ve proven more reliable than some other budget options I’ve encountered.

Breaking Down the Features of Hawke Sport Optics 2pc 1in Weaver High 1in Extension Rings

Specifications

The Hawke Sport Optics 2pc 1in Weaver High 1in Extension Rings are designed for mounting scopes with a 1-inch tube diameter onto Weaver-style rails.

  • Material: The rings are constructed from aluminum, making them lightweight and resistant to corrosion.
  • Height: The “High” designation means the rings provide a height of 2.1 inches, measured from the base of the ring to the center of the scope tube. This height is suitable for scopes with larger objective lenses.
  • Extension: The rings offer a 1-inch extension forward, allowing for greater flexibility in achieving proper eye relief.
  • Mounting System: They utilize a Weaver rail interface, a common and widely compatible mounting system.
  • Screws: The rings feature double hex screws on each side of the top cap, providing a secure and even clamping force.
  • Finish: The anodized finish provides a durable and corrosion-resistant surface.
  • Cant: The rings have a 0 MOA cant, meaning they are designed for use on rifles where the scope’s internal adjustment range is sufficient for the desired distances.
  • Internal Cushion Tape: The rings include internal cushion tape to prevent damage to the scope tube.

These specifications are important because they dictate the compatibility of the rings with different scopes and rifles. The aluminum construction keeps the overall weight down, while the high height accommodates larger objective lenses. The 1-inch extension is crucial for rifles with limited mounting space or scopes with long eye relief. The double hex screws and internal cushion tape ensure a secure and damage-free mounting solution.
